Using the Configuration Menu (continued) Advanced > Firewall Firewall Rules is an advanced feature that is used to deny, allow or count traffic that passes through the DWL-1700AP. The Firewall Rules that you create will appear in the list at the bottom of the page. Please be sure to Click Apply, after you have made changes or additions. Firewall Service- Select Enabled to enable the Firewall Service feature Rule Name- Enter the name for the Firewall Rule Schedule- To schedule the time during which the Firewall Rule will be in effect select OFF or Always Action- Choose to Accept, Deny or Count the Firewall Rule Priority- Select the Priority status of the Firewall Rule Protocol- Select the Protocol of the Firewall Rule IPNetmaskPort- Enter the IP Address of both the Source and the Destination of the Firewall Rule Enter the Subnet Mask of both the Source and the Destination of the Firewall Rule Enter the Port of both the Source and the Destination of the Firewall Rule 20
